Nigerian Book Scam

We gets loads of scam emails and attempts to defraud but this one was more amusing than most.

So here we present the chronology of a scam, what sets it aside is that I played along, it involves Golden Age Crime Fiction (as opposed to cell phones etc).
I was emailed by Charles Richardson, an elderly collector living in South London, with a collection to sell.
Despite this description sounding typically English his prose suggests English is a second, or even third language: Bold text is Charles, italic is my reply

The Nigerian Book Scam

Hello
I am Charles Richardson from south London uk, I have some of the books and i can sell for your club .then if you are ready to pay some good money then i will send you my list of books in my library about crime.those you have in your list and others.

please I only need a serious business minded individuals to deal with in any thing i do

I will be expecting your call or write me

Charles Richardson

Hi Charles
thanks for the email, much appreciated. We are always interested in pre war crime fiction, UK first editions in dust jacket.
Loook forward to hearing from you
All the best
Rod

HI Rod

Thanks for your mail, like what i told you i have some in my personal library.i will sell for your club or you if you are ready to offer me something reasonable.

How much can you offer for each of the books and how soon do you need the books, how many can you buy.

All the best

Charles.

Hi Charles
obviously it depends on what books you have as to how much they are worth or indeed if we can buy them.
We would need some idea of authors titles, presence of dust jacket, first editions etc
Regards
Rod

Here are some example

THE MURDER OF GERALDINE FOSTER

THE CRIME OF THE CENTURY

THE MURDER OF THE NIGHT CLUB LADY

THE MURDER OF THE CIRCUS QUEEN

MURDER OF A STARTLED LADY

MURDER OF A MAN AFRAID OF WOMEN

MURDER AT BUZZARD’S BAY

DEADLY SECRET

Hello Charles,
thanks for the sample list, greatly appreciated.
Are the books hardback first editions with their dust jackets ? If they have dust jackets then they should all be priced at 7/6 if they are first editions
If so they are the sort of titles we would be interested in buying
All the best
Rod

HI ROD,

THANKS FOR YOR MAIL. THEY ARE FIRST EDITION AND WITH DUST JACKETS.

THE PRICE IS OK AND HOW MANY DO YOU NEED ALSO HOW SOON?

READ FROM YOU SOONEST

CHARLES

Hi Charles
I would potentially be interested in buying all the books you mention and any similar.
Could you give me an idea of how many books and a rough idea as to the money you are looking for?

It does not bind you to a figure and I regularly pay a lot more, it just gives me some idea as to whether it is viable to proceed or not

Thanks again Charles
All the best
Rod

ROD,

Thanks for your mail.the books are about 30 and i can sell for say 320.00 pounds.and if is ok by you let me know how soon you are paying for it.

All the best.

charles

Hi Charles
if you want to send the books on approval I can make payment by cheque immediately upon receipt of books
I will send full details if this meets with your approval
Regards
Rod

Rod,

Thanks for your mail.i get my money before i can send you the books .

I dont think i will accept any check becouse i have some problem with that last time i was selling my car.

I will prefer cash by western union money transfer or call money.

Charles.

This all took one week with the last one arriving today, I am tempted to continue but I’m feeling bored now
